The SSC CGL Tier 1 examination includes four major subjects:

| Subject | Questions | Marks |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| English Language | 25 | 50 | 60 Minutes |
| General Intelligence & Reasoning | 25 | 50 | |
| Quantitative Aptitude | 25 | 50 | |
| General Awareness | 25 | 50 | |
| Total | 100 | 200 | 60 Minutes |
* 0.50 marks will be deducted for each wrong answer.
